我国沙漠化过程中的植被演替研究概述

摘    要:通过回顾植被演替研究的历史,简要论述了植被演替的理论与发展。综述了我国沙漠化过程中植被演替的研究现状。指出植物群落的逆行、进展演替实质上对应着沙漠化的正、逆过程。植被演替问题的研究与农、林、牧生产和经济活动紧密相连,是合理经营和利用自然资源的理论基础。因此,在沙漠化过程中,从植被演替与生物多样性、种群、环境的关系着手深入研究,有利于提出植被恢复的合理途径,改善生态环境,实现沙漠化土地的整治和可持续发展。

关 键 词:沙漠化  植被演替  群落多样性

A Brief Review on Vegetation Succession Research in Desertification Processes of China

Abstract:Based on study reports and publications,this paper briefly reviews the development history of basic theories in vegetation succession.The classic theory of mono-climax though used to be an important approach in succession research,has elicited much criticism because of its overlooking the importance of time and soil effects.The idea of polyclimax,climax pattern,ecological succession and ecosystem development have enriched and developed the modern theories of succession.Based on the preceding theories,research situation in vegetation succession is examined in desertification.Regressive or progressive succession of plant community is virtually positive or negative processes of desertification.Research on vegetation succession,which is connected with agriculture,forestry and graziery production and economy activities,is the theoretical basis on suitably managing and utilizing natural resources.Thus,further research on relationships of vegetation succession and biodiversity,population and environment during desertification is the efficient key to finding ways of vegetation restoration,improving ecological environment,controlling desertification and realizing sustainable development.
Keywords:desertification  vegetation succession  community diversity
